About Glacier Ridge Elementary

Glacier Ridge Elementary is one of the moderately sized elementary campuss in Dublin, Ohio, part of Dublin City, with 559 students on its rolls from grades K through 5. Compared to the state average of about 404 students per school, that is 38% larger than typical.

Dublin City runs 23 schools in total, collectively educating 16,967 students. Glacier Ridge Elementary is one of those campuses.

In terms of who attends, Glacier Ridge Elementary lists that the most-represented group is White (52%), with the rest of the student body spread across multiple groups. Other groups include 36% Asian, 7% multiracial, 4% Hispanic. That is visibly less White than the county at large, where the share is closer to 85%.

On the resource side, Glacier Ridge Elementary lists 32 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 17.8:1. That tracks the state average closely. Around 4% of the student body qualifies for free or reduced-price meals, which schools and policymakers use as a rough income-mix signal. By comparison, Union County runs at roughly 19%, so the school's eligibility rate is below the surrounding baseline.

On a residual basis (actual vs predicted given the student mix), Glacier Ridge Elementary tracks the demographic baseline. The model predicts 87.2% given the school's FRL share; actual proficiency is 87.4%.

Zooming out to the county, Union County reports that median household income runs about $112,322, roughly 39% of adults have completed at least a four-year degree, and roughly 4% of residents live below the federal poverty line. In all, Union County runs 19 public schools (combined enrollment of about 12,597 students), of which Glacier Ridge Elementary is one.

The closest other public school is Deer Run Elementary School, roughly 1.2 miles away.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ools. On composite proficiency, Glacier Ridge Elementary comes 5th of 9 in the immediate cluster, behind the nearby-schools average of 88.2%.

Trend over the last 7 years. Over the past 7-year window, the student count fell 20%: 701 students in 2018 compared to 559 in 2025. Over the same period, the White share contracted from 56% to 52%. Class-load math has narrowed: from 58.4:1 in 2018 to 17.8:1 in 2025.
